Nancy Graham
Nancy L. (Snider) Graham, 80, died Wednesday, May 27, at home, leaving a legacy for others to emulate.
She was born Oct. 29, 1939, in Milford to Marshall “Shorty” and Marie (Whitehead) Miller.
On May 25, 1957, she married Larry L. Snider. He died Jan. 15, 1986.
On Nov. 28, 1987, she married Douglas L. Graham in Milford.
He survives, along with a daughter, Melissa (Phil) Dowty, Goshen; three sons, David (Marla) Snider and Scott (Peggy) Snider, both of New Paris and Troy (Sandy) Snider, Milford; two step-sons, Andrew (Marti) Graham, Seattle, Wash., and Blake (Monica) Graham, Fort Worth, Texas; 13 grandchildren; seven great-grandchildren; and two sisters, Bonnie Yoder and Phyllis Sorensen, both of Milford.
Along with her parents and first husband, she was preceded in death by a sister, Delilah Wuthrich and a step-son, Corey Graham.
Nancy was an active member of Nappanee Missionary Church, where she was involved with missions and served as a facilitator for a grief share group at the church. She also enjoyed gardening and cooking.
